Thanks Jerin. - I am still looking at the event record mode. I just wonder why we have this notion per tracepoint. The documentation talks about it being an attribute of the trace buffers, and the described behavior looks fine. But if we can set this mode per tracepoints, once a trace buffer is full, won't it be hard to figure out why some events have been caught and not others? - Another comment, on the form, I can see that we talk about dataplane tracepoints and fastpath API. Is there a difference? or could everything be named in a consistent way (the headers would have to be aligned too)? - Do we really need to export the rte_trace_lib_eal_generic_* trace points? They seem more like examples and I don't see a usage outside of the tests. -- David Marchand
